Why Should Athletes Be Drug Tested? (7 Reasons)
Athletes are expected to perform at the highest levels, so they become tempted to use performance-enhancing drugs (PEDs). This is where drug testing athletes ensure that athletes compete fairly, maintain their health, and uphold the integrity of their respective sports.
Here are the main reasons why drug testing athletes is needed:
- Drug testing creates a level playing field where athletes compete based on their natural abilities, training, and dedication.
- It also helps protect athletes from risking their health since PEDs can cause severe health problems, including heart disease, liver damage, and other long-term issues.
- Testing helps maintain the integrity of sports by ensuring that victories are based on merit and hard work. Also, fans and sponsors can trust that athletes achieve success through hard work.
- When athletes know that they may be drug tested at any time, they are discouraged from using drugs and enhance their abilities instead.
- Another reason is public trust. Drug testing assures fans of fairness and enhances the credibility of both the athletes and the competition organizations.
- Regular testing can also reduce the risk of scandals that can harm the reputation of sports teams, leagues, and individual athletes.

How Often Do Olympic Athletes Get Drug Tested?
Drug testing athletes during the games maintains the fairness and integrity of the Olympics. That’s why Olympic athletes face the strictest drug testing protocols. They are tested year-round, at any time, without prior notice, and in and out of competition. This method ensures they aren’t using banned substances. In addition, when the games start, they are tested frequently, especially if they perform exceptionally well or break records.

What Drugs Are Athletes Tested For?
Athletes are mostly tested for PEDs like anabolic steroids, human growth hormones, and stimulants. For endurance sports, athletes use methods like transfusions to increase their red blood cell count, so they are often tested for blood doping. In sports with strict weight classes, athletes are tested for substances that help with rapid weight loss, like diuretics.
